Demand for Portable Isolation Room Market To Soar from Use Industries and Push Revenues in Market : Fact.MR

The global medical device market is undergoing significant changes owing to technological advancements to aid human health. The market is expected to expand at a CAGR of more than 5% with significant contribution from the isolation market over 2022-2032. Rapid increase in biologically-contaminated patients with COVID -19 has propelled the isolation market.

The portable isolation room market increased in valuation from US$ 31.4 Mn in 2017 to US$ 43.5 Mn in 2021, reflecting a CAGR of 8.5%. The sudden outburst caused by SARS-CoV-2 (sever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2) saw a quick increase in infected patients globally.

Rapid surge in novel coronavirus infectious patients with various strains resulted in increased demand for hospitals, hospital beds, and ICUs. However, limited expansion of hospitals against the upsurge in the requirement for patient isolation stimulated the increase in demand for portable patient isolation rooms.

Which Occupancy is High in Portable Isolation Rooms?

Under the occupancy segment, the portable isolation room market is segmented into single and multiple occupancy portable isolation rooms.

The single occupancy portable isolation rooms segment is forecast to dominate the market with a market share of 64.6% in 2022, and is projected to witness growth at 4.5%.

Prior to COVID-19, one of the key uses of portable isolation rooms was in war zones to provide a safe environment to the defense forces to recover. In such a scenario, multiple occupancy isolation rooms were of preference; however, the sudden hit of the dangerous virus gave rise to demand for single patient isolation rooms among the civil population.

Some single patient isolation rooms are built with personal en suite bathrooms and anterooms, which is creating a new trend. The multiple occupancy segment holds 34.8% of the overall market share, and is projected to expand at a CAGR of 4.3% over the forecast years of 2022-2032.
